Cameroonian Achille Mbembe wins German book prize

Cameroonian political scientist and author Achille Mbembe has received the prestigious “Geschwister Scholl-Preis” 2015 for the German edition of his latest book ‘Critique de la raison nègre’. His book reflects the history of globalisation and deals with capitalism, colonialism and racism. ITB Berlin celebrates 50th anniversary

The 50th anniversary of the International Tourism Bourse (ITB) Berlin will be held from Wednesday to Sunday, 9 to 13 March, on the Berlin Exhibition Grounds ICC.
